Choosing the Right Online Forums and Communities

Select platforms that are active, well-moderated, and relevant to your exam subject. Popular options include dedicated educational forums, social media groups, and subreddit communities. Look for forums with a high level of engagement and positive feedback from members.

  • Reddit: Subreddits like r/Students, r/ExamHelp, or subject-specific groups.
  • Discord: Study servers focused on specific exams or subjects.
  • Facebook Groups: Communities centered around exam preparation and study tips.
  • Educational Forums: Dedicated sites like The Student Room or College Confidential.

Tips for Safe and Effective Participation

While forums are valuable, ensure you use them wisely:

  • Verify information: Cross-check advice and resources with official exam boards.
  • Avoid plagiarism: Use shared resources ethically and cite sources when necessary.
  • Maintain privacy: Be cautious about sharing personal details.
  • Stay focused: Use forums as a supplement, not a substitute for structured study.
